Understanding the Basics of Mahjong

The game of Mahjong is played with a set of 144 tiles based on Chinese characters and symbols. While there are many variations of Mahjong, the most common version played in international circles is the Cantonese version. Each player starts with 13 tiles, aiming to form sets and pairs by drawing and discarding tiles, ultimately achieving a winning hand.

Tile Categories

Mahjong tiles are divided into three primary categories: suits, honor tiles, and bonus tiles. Within suits, there are Bamboo, Characters, and Dots, each ranging from one to nine. Honor tiles encompass the Wind tiles (East, South, West, North) and the Dragon tiles (Red, Green, White). Forming Winning Hands

A winning Mahjong hand comprises four sets and one pair. A set can be a "Pung" (three identical tiles), a "Chow" (a sequence of three consecutive tiles of the same suit), or a "Kong" (four identical tiles). The pair acts as the hand's anchor, completing its structure.
